The New York Times has finally come clean about Joe Biden’s ability to handle the presidency for another four years. In a recent article, the left-leaning publication admitted that Biden is looking older and slower with each passing day, making it hard to imagine him taking on the world’s most stressful job for another term.

This revelation comes after months of the Times dismissing concerns about Biden’s age and abilities. Just six months ago, they accused people of using ‘cheap fakes’ to make Biden appear older and more feeble than he actually is. They claimed that videos circulating online were misleading and lacked important context, painting an unflattering picture of the president.

Now, however, the Times has had a change of heart. They acknowledge that Biden’s age is catching up with him and that he may not be up to the task of serving another term. This newfound realization has sparked criticism from conservatives who have long been aware of Biden’s limitations.

It’s a stark contrast from the Times’ previous stance on Biden’s mental acuity. They once touted him as sharp and capable, only to backtrack on their claims as time went on. The inconsistency in their reporting has raised questions about their credibility and motives.
